Important: SendWILL Email Popup New Feature Updates!
We’re excited to announce the latest updates to SendWILL Email Popup v3.0.3. This release brings several improvements to campaign emails, subscriber management, popup display rules, GDPR settings, automation analytics, and overall user experience.
Campaign Email Enhancements
You can now create custom discounts directly for Campaign Emails, making it easier to build more flexible and targeted email marketing campaigns.



We’ve also added support for reusing previously sent linked emails. Merchants can now duplicate and resend an existing email workflow instead of creating a new one from scratch, helping save time when running similar campaigns.
Subscriber Updates
Subscriber CSV import is now supported.
Merchants can import standard Shopify customer list CSV files, with support for files up to 10 MB in size. This makes it easier to migrate and manage existing customer data inside SendWILL Email Popup.


Popup Trigger Rule Improvements
We’ve added several improvements to popup trigger rules to help merchants reach customers at better moments during their shopping journey.
Mobile Exit Intent is now supported. On mobile devices, popups can be triggered when shoppers scroll upward by approximately 5%.

Popups can now also be displayed after customers click Add to Cart, helping merchants capture more leads or offer timely promotions during the purchase journey.


Custom link triggers have also been improved. They are no longer restricted by conflicts with other display rules and can now trigger popups independently.

For Popup Spin Wheel campaigns, we’ve added a “Discount Not Won” notification, so merchants can better manage the user experience when shoppers do not receive a discount.

Opt-In popups now also support a separate mobile image display setting, allowing merchants to better optimize popup visuals for mobile users.
GDPR Settings
We’ve added GDPR compliance settings for end users.
Merchants who would like to enable GDPR privacy consent for their store can do so by adding the GDPR privacy consent code snippet to their theme.liquid file.


Automation Flow Analytics
The Automation Flow details page now includes a date range filter in the analytics section at the top of the page.

This helps merchants review automation performance within a selected time period and better understand the effectiveness of their flows.
Automation Flow – New Subscribe Event Enhancement
The New Subscribe event has been enhanced to support subscription triggers from Shopify Customers.

Previously, this trigger only supported subscriptions created through SendWILL App Subscribers. With this update, the trigger conditions have been expanded to include Shopify Customer subscriptions as well, giving merchants more complete automation coverage.
